    How old is Bishop anyway? I mean, let's just say he ages slower because he's a mutant and so still looks young... but I don't think he is that young.

    I mean, suppose he came back to the past and was 35 years old (max possible age he could be) - a veteran XSE officer with plenty of experience and let's consider the timeline in Powers of X. He stays with them for lets say two years (the time between the Moira/Xavier/Magneto schism and the genocide at Genosha) during which time he spends at least a year in the Chronomancer's future. So at maximum he's 38 now. Let's say two more years till Hope is born (that part of PoX timeline makes no sense at all, but whatever), he's 40. He spends 12 years with Stryfe in the future, so 52. Put all the time when he's back in the past as a year, he's 53. So at maximum, Bishop is 53 years old. But because of his powers, he might still genetically be 35 at max. Suppose he was 25 (which is the minimum he could be) when he came to the past, then he'd be 43 at max.

    I'm going to retread some old ground here so bear with me. Bishop was brought onto the Marauders team for reasons that still aren't clear to me. He became a member of the Hellfire Club so that he could watch Kate's back.

    So when Shaw attempts to kill Kate, not only does Bishop not protect her, he doesn't even know that it was Shaw because they don't tell him! Kate and Emmy decided to handle things on their own without telling the one person who was asked by Kate herself to watch her back.

    To top it off, Bishop who is a detective didn't even try to investigate who attempted to kill Kate. So again the question remains, why is Bishop on a team where he's not doing anything other than filling space.
